My Grandmother is Bedridden for past 4 years. For past 1 month she is having Bedsores in between the shoulder blades which measures around 5×5 cm. Initially we did dressing and it healed leaving a black scar. But for past 2 days we noticed pus discharge from one edge of the scar with foul smell. Inside the scar it is fluctuant. My questions are :- 1. Do we have to remove the entire scar and do the dressing or through the opening in the edge of the scar irrigating and giving antibiotic wash along with betadine gauze packing in the abscess cavity is enough? 2. To prevent further bed sores which bed is good? Water bed or Air Bed?

Female | 92

As for the wound, it is crucial to clean it well and cover it with antibiotic gauze. This is the way it can be healed. Concerning the prevention of further sores, both water beds and air beds are useful by alleviating the pressure on her skin. Be sure to move her body every so often so that she doesn't get too much pressure in one spot. This will also help to prevent more bedsores.

I am a 18 year old male, 56kg and a filipino. Three days ago, I ate a spicy food and a day after that I felt a burning sensation when doing my business in the toilet. A day after that I felt a bump near my anus and I'm thinking if its a boil or a pimple. I know that having a boil is pretty hard so I'm scared of what it is and i dont know what to do to stop it from getting worse

Male | 18

You may have something referred to as a perianal abscess. When bacteria infect a tiny gland around the anus, this can cause a painful lump. Soaking in warm water may help relieve discomfort. Don’t squeeze or pop it—try to keep the area clean instead. If it becomes worse or doesn’t get better, you should go see your doctor for more help.
